Transaction 759380fa9367b3530732f3a0e761749a302f467c60417b969a536392a050b01c
1 Input
2 Outputs
- 759380fa9367b3530732f3a0e761749a302f467c60417b969a536392a050b01c:0
- 759380fa9367b3530732f3a0e761749a302f467c60417b969a536392a050b01c:1
value 128029
address 3H9sbNddLMRjVmTnTBoDpQEbT2JchYeA9r
value 380700
address bc1qf9tu0wuy2de033jqkj5h7uzhe6xtcygd0yz4vx